I don't know enough about personal fit in man blocking vs zone blocking vs ?? to be able to analyze what a major scheme shift would mean. But I am concerned that it might mean revamping the current personal.

Shifting Lewis to LG to allow Jackson to play RG seemed to hurt Lewis' development. He seemed to have Pro-Bowl potential but floundered with the new position. If they are going to change schemes I would like them to build around Lewis and try to play towards his strengths.

Seattle was ranked 15th in pass block win rate, A massive improvement over the past 5 or so years. What has stunk is that they ranked 28th in rush blocking win rate.
